PROOF Research’s match-grade carbon fiber barrels are stronger, lighter, as accurate as the finest precision steel barrels and will maintain their performance in the harshest conditions. PROOF didn’t invent carbon fiber-wrapped barrels. They just perfected them.

  • Up to 64% lighter than traditional steel barrels
  • Match-grade accuracy
  • Improved heat dissipation for cooler and longer lasting barrels
  • No point-of-impact shift during high-volume fire
  • Reduced harmonic barrel vibration
  • Unprecedented durability

Your Pre-Fit Tikka bolt-action barrel will arrive chambered and threaded in various calibers. We recommend a qualified gunsmith install the pre-fit barrel on your rifle. These barrels come threaded on the muzzle end.

THE ONLY CARBON FIBER-WRAPPED BARREL APPROVED FOR USE BY THE U.S. MILITARY.

This patented manufacturing process begins with full-profile, match-grade 416R stainless steel barrel blanks that are made in our firearms division. These blanks are then turned down to a significantly reduced profile greatly reducing weight. This reduced contour barrel is then filament-wrapped with high-strength, aerospace-grade carbon fibers impregnated with a high-thermal conductivity matrix resin developed by our aerospace materials division.

Carbon Wrapping Of Proof Research Barrels

The aerospace-grade carbon fiber used is 10 times stronger than stainless steel and has a specific stiffness nearly 6 times greater than steel. But strength and stiffness are only part of the equation. Heat conductivity and thermal expansion are also of paramount importance when developing a match-grade, carbon fiber barrel. Our helical wrapping pattern favors the longitudinal thermal diffusivity of the carbon fibers (along the length of the barrel) allowing them to dissipate the heat emanating from the steel liner rather than insulate it. This is achieved through phonon transport in the direction of the continuous fibers and greatly reduces the mirage effect intrinsic in heavy steel barrels.

However, because our unique bonding agent contains a high-thermal pitch fiber—similar to those proven in Formula One and aerospace applications—our barrels also conduct heat very effectively through the wall (thickness) of the barrel, greatly increasing thermal conductivity and resulting in barrels that stay cooler and maintain accuracy over longer sessions of fire.

After wrapping, barrels are cured and consolidated then ground to their final contour. The end result is an aerospace-grade, high-fiber volume fraction composite barrel with less than 1% porosity suitable for the most extreme environments and capable of shot-after-shot accuracy that will impress the most veteran hunter or precision marksmen.
